The 'Crisis of the Third Century', also known as the period of 'barracks emperors', was a time of profound instability when Rome had twenty-six emperors in fifty years, leading to civil wars and economic crises, yet also saw cultural growth with the rise of Christianity.
The period in question, known as the Crisis of the Third Century, was marked by political instability and was indeed very close to destroying the Roman Empire. Answer choice (e) 'the barracks emperors' correctly identifies this era, in which Rome experienced extreme turmoil with a rapid succession of rulers, seeing no fewer than twenty-six emperors in the span of roughly fifty years.
This period of upheaval, which lasted from about 235 to 284 CE, was characterized by civil wars, economic crises, and external threats, seeing emperors often raised to power by the military. Despite these challenges, this era also saw cultural development, particularly the spread of Christianity, signaling the transition to Late Antiquity and setting the foundation for the Middle Ages.

Newton's first law is called the law of inertia because it explains that objects resist changes in their motion due to inertia, which is related to their mass. Inertia is not the same as friction, nor does it describe the application of force.
Explanation:
Newton’s first law is sometimes referred to as the law of inertia because it describes the tendency of objects to maintain their state of motion. A fundamental aspect of this law is that it takes a net external force to change an object’s motion. This means that an object at rest will stay at rest, known as static inertia, and an object in motion will continue moving at a constant velocity in a straight line, called dynamic inertia, unless acted upon by such a force.
The correct reason why Newton's first law is called the law of inertia is because inertia is the tendency of objects to resist changes in their motion. This property is inherently related to an object's mass—the more massive an object is, the more inertia it has, and consequently, the more force it takes to change its state of motion, whether it be starting, stopping, or changing direction.
By contrast, friction is a force that opposes the motion of objects, and while it often acts as the external force that changes an object's state of motion, it is not synonymous with inertia. Therefore, the first statement is incorrect. Similarly, inertia does not describe the application of force but rather the resistance to such force, making the third and fourth statements incorrect as well.

The technologies that helped settlers establish farms on the Great Plains include the steel plow, windmill, barbed wire, and reaper. Hence, Option (D) is correct.
The steel plow was crucial for breaking through the tough soil of the region, enabling farmers to cultivate the land effectively.
The windmill harnessed the strong winds prevalent on the Great Plains to pump water from underground wells, providing a vital water source for irrigation and livestock.
Barbed wire played a pivotal role in fencing off fields and protecting crops and livestock from wandering animals.
Lastly, the reaper significantly increased the efficiency of grain harvesting, allowing farmers to gather crops quickly and efficiently.
Thus, these technologies made it possible for settlers to establish and maintain successful farms in a challenging environment.

The Four Noble Truths, nirvana, and the Eightfold Path are foundational concepts in Buddhism, which prescribe a moral and enlightened path to overcome suffering and achieve a state of peace called nirvana.
Explanation:
The Four Noble Truths, nirvana, and the Eightfold Path are central concepts in the religion of Buddhism. The Four Noble Truths outline the reality of suffering and the cause of this suffering, which is attachment to desires. To overcome suffering and achieve nirvana, a state of liberation and ultimate peace, Buddhists follow the Eightfold Path. This path consists of eight practices: right understanding, right mindedness, right speech, right action, right living, right effort, right attentiveness, and right concentration. Collectively, these guide individuals toward moral living, ethical conduct, and spiritual development.
Buddhism is known as a dharmic faith focused on duty, personal responsibility, and the moral life. It suggests that life is characterized by suffering which can only be overcome through the path to enlightenment known as the Middle Way, represented by the Eightfold Path to reach nirvana.

Elizabeth Blackwell was born on February 3, 1821 in Bristol, England, but moved to the United States in 1831 along with her family. Elizabeth was the first woman who managed to practice a medical profession in the United States, which is why she is considered an example of the struggle for female emancipation.
It should be noted that the impulse that led her to want to be a doctor was the death of a friend, who before dying of a terminal illness told Blackwell that she wished she had been treated by a woman. This event marked her life and the idea of being a doctor emerged in her, so she sent letters of request to all the universities of New York and Pennsylvania, without receiving a response.
After ten universities rejected her application, she was admitted to Geneva Medical College (New York) and on January 11, 1849 she became the first woman to receive a medical degree in medicine in the United States.

The Camp David Accords were signed by Egyptian President Anwar el-Sadat and Israeli Prime Minister Menachem Begin on September 17, 1978 after twelve days of secret negotiations with the mediation of the President of the United States, Jimmy Carter, and through which Egypt and Israel signed peace in the territorial conflicts between both countries.
